if you're pursuing something more serious then you should always change strings when it starts losing its tone
strings suffer wear and tear, whether you're playing electric, acoustic, or classical.
be sure to change them time to time, if you're a very avid player, should be anywhere from 3-5 weeks but if you're rather casuals and don't mind it that much, it's about 2-3months imo
